There are a number of potential causes of the high rate of divorce in the United States ... 1 of 5 reasons : Humor, Money, Height, Personality and ...Jul 25, 2020 · The share of marriages that end in divorce increased through the 1960s to the 1990s. In 1963, only 1.5% of couples had divorced before their fifth anniversary, 7.8% had divorced before their tenth, and 19% before their twentieth anniversary. By the mid-1990s this had increased to 11%, 25% and 38%, respectively. 5 days ago · Divorce Statistics for Canadians. The number of divorces in Canada in 2020 was the lowest since 1973. The peak year for divorces was 1987, when there were 97,773 divorces. The rate of divorces in Canada has declined since 1991. In 2020, the average length of divorce proceedings was 5.8 months. Marriages in Canada last, on average, 15 years. It’s estimated that between 40% and 50% of marriages in the U.S. end in divorce. Between 15% and 25% of participants in various studies listed domestic violence as an important reason for divorce. And in a study focusing on older divorced couples, more than a third of participants listed verbal, emotional, or physical abuse as one of the three main reasons for their divorce. Copeland is th...Abuse. The most serious reason to consider divorce is any persistent pattern of spousal abuse. This certainly encompasses physical abuse, which can place one spouse’s life in immediate danger. However, patterns of verbal or financial abuse can also be corrosive and are very valid grounds to leave the marriage.
